Transaction 59918c3c15451c640dd692bbb578b7b486199a7b507df66f3a5defd5c020be2a
1 Input
1 Output
-
59918c3c15451c640dd692bbb578b7b486199a7b507df66f3a5defd5c020be2a:0
- value
- 1536280
- script pubkey
- OP_0 OP_PUSHBYTES_20 916fea7ba5ab75e95e0899d7568a72678b1b67fa
- address
- bc1qj9h757a94d67jhsgn8t4dznjv793kel6p4gr66